PHP中的Parse error: syntax error解决方法

 
更多

在使用PHP进行开发的过程中,经常会遇到一种错误提示:“Parse error: syntax error”,这意味着代码中存在语法错误。这种错误很常见,但有时确实很难找到问题所在。在本篇博客中,我们将介绍一些常见的出错原因以及解决方法。

1. 检查括号和引号是否匹配

在PHP中,括号和引号是成对出现的,如果不正确地使用了括号和引号,就会导致语法错误。例如,下面的代码会出现语法错误:

if ($x == 1) {
  echo "x等于1";
}

正确的写法是:

if ($x == 1) {
  echo "x等于1";
}

2. 检查变量和函数名是否正确

在PHP中,变量和函数名是区分大小写的。如果在代码中使用了一个未定义的变量或函数名,就会出现语法错误。例如,下面的代码会出现语法错误:

echo $message;

正确的写法是:

$message = "Hello, World!";
echo $message;

3. 检查语句结束是否正确

在PHP中,每个语句都应该以分号(;)结束。如果忘记在语句末尾添加分号,就会出现语法错误。例如,下面的代码会出现语法错误:

$x = 1
echo $x;

正确的写法是:

$x = 1;
echo $x;

4. 检查代码块是否正确嵌套

在PHP中,代码块需要正确地嵌套。如果不正确地嵌套代码块,就会出现语法错误。例如,下面的代码会出现语法错误:

for ($i = 0; $i < 10; $i++) {
echo $i;
}

正确的写法是:

for ($i = 0; $i < 10; $i++) {
  echo $i;
}

总结:

在PHP中,遇到“Parse error: syntax error”错误时,首先应该仔细检查代码中是否存在括号和引号不匹配、变量和函数名不存在、语句结束缺少分号、代码块嵌套错误等常见原因。通过仔细检查代码,并根据具体的错误信息进行定位,我们可以很容易地解决这些语法错误。

希望本篇博客对你有所帮助,让你更加轻松地处理PHP中的语法错误。如果有其他问题,请随时向我提问。

打赏

本文固定链接: https://www.cxy163.net/archives/7129 | 绝缘体

该日志由 绝缘体.. 于 2022年02月14日 发表在 未分类 分类下, 你可以发表评论,并在保留原文地址及作者的情况下引用到你的网站或博客。
原创文章转载请注明: PHP中的Parse error: syntax error解决方法 | 绝缘体
关键字: , , , ,

PHP中的Parse error: syntax error解决方法:等您坐沙发呢!

发表评论


快捷键:Ctrl+Enter